The VM series is a mechanical, poppet valve. Their compact size requires little mounting space. The VM series offers a wide variety of actuator styles and flow capacity up to 1.0 Cv.Actuator replacements for VM100, VM200, VM400 and VM800, Roller levers, plungers, toggle levers, rod levers, push buttons and twist selectors, MECHANICAL VALVE, MECHANICAL VALVE, I98, 12 lb
